Company and Competitor Profile
Company Overview
Menbur is a family-owned company that has been a key player in the niche market of evening, party, special occasion, and bridal shoes since its inception in 1967 in Granada, Spain. Expanding its operations over the years, Menbur also offers evening bags, accessories, and clothing. The company has a remarkable international presence with 41 stores in Spain, Poland, UAE (Abu Dhabi and Dubai), Kuwait, and Qatar, and has recently ventured into the South African market, demonstrating its commitment to geographic expansion.
Product Offerings
Menbur stands out with its exclusive collection of bridal shoes, reputed to be one of the broadest assortments globally. Their product range also includes evening shoes, high heels, sneakers, boots, and an extensive selection of handbags such as clutches and evening bags. Their online shop facilitates easy access to the latest trends in occasion footwear and fashion items, enhancing their competitive edge in the market.

Franchise and Operational Strategy
Menbur's franchise model includes structured annual training programs covering visual merchandising, customer service, and new product collections. The franchise framework is further strengthened by comprehensive support and the provision of seasonal style guides to ensure alignment with Menbur's brand ethos and market trends.
